!!'''Gein'''
http://static.tvtropes.org/pmwiki/pub/images/tumblr_m4iuodvwaf1r4fbq9_8532.jpg
The last remaining descendant of a small group of people who mastered the art of mechanics in the Middle Ages. He creates puppet like suits out of corpses, [[spoiler:most notably the Iwanbou series]]. He is actually an old man yet he is very strong due to controlling his heavy puppets for so long. The diamond edged steel wires he uses (Zankosen) to control his puppets can also be used as a weapon as they are sharp enough to cut flesh and break bone. Gein just wants to test out his creations and needs to be around men of battle to do it since according to him, the forefront of technology is always in battle.

!!Kujiranami Hyogo
http://static.tvtropes.org/pmwiki/pub/images/kujiranami_1968.jpg
A huge man with an odd mouth and only one arm, as he lost it to Kenshin during the Bakumatsu period. Looking for revenge, he sided with Enishi. He goes berserk at the mention of Kenshin and can put an Armstrong cannon on his arm stump to fight.

!!Inui Banjin
http://static.tvtropes.org/pmwiki/pub/images/250px-banjin_ken-706_2593.png
Also known as "Iron Armored Banjin", is an hot blooded martial artist who holds a grudge against Kenshin for killing his master Tatsumi. Not very bright, uses his whole body as a weapon and wields thick metal armor on his arms called "Tekko", which serves as a shield and Knuckleduster.

!!Otowa Hyoko
http://static.tvtropes.org/pmwiki/pub/images/250px-hyoko_ken-706_6875.png
The "Master of Hidden Weapons", is an effemminate assassin who just loves to kill people with his hidden lethal weapons. Wants to avenge his friend Nakajo, who was killed by Kenshin.
